STUDY ON LOW POWER CONSUMPTION OF KALMAN FILTER

摘要

In the 21st century,high-precision and high-resolution velocity measurement has been realized,and ultrasonic flow measurement technology has been greatly improved.However,the flow measurement algorithms of mature products are relatively confidential at home and abroad.Research shows that the Kalman filter algorithm has application potential in the monitoring and measurement of ultrasonic flow.Therefore,this paper applies the Kalman filter algorithm to the current ultrasonic flow measurement technology and proposes an improved Kalman filter algorithm that adapts to the change of flow characteristics.The Kalman filter algorithm is successfully applied to the ultrasonic velocity measurement system by introducing an adaptive factor into the algorithm.When the flow rate is 1000 mLmin"1,the measurement error range is reduced from ±50 mL min"1 to ±5 mL min'1.At the same time,correction parameters a and b are introduced respectively,finally the accurate measurement of the flow rate by the ultrasonic testing system at low flow rate and high flow rate is realized,and the error ranges are reduced to ±0.1 mL min'1 and ±2 mL min" 1 respectively,which ensures the accuracy and stability of flow measurement,reduces the calculation complexity and takes into account the low power consumption performance.
